Ticket: Config drift on Pondermill's order service pooler. Staging and prod disagree on max pool size and idle timeout, which explains the intermittent connection exhaustion Priya observed Tuesday. Drift appears to have started after the hotfix rollback two weeks ago; the automation never reconciled. Proposal: make prod authoritative, re-sync staging, and add a drift alert. For the sync discussion, the values currently live in production are listed below.

settings of kajep-kawip:
[zorys]
host = zorys.urlaqgrid.corp
user = zorys_svc
database = zorys_prod

### Step 2 — Swap in the Tallyhawk sidecar

Replace the old in-process metrics exporter with the Tallyhawk aggregation sidecar. For the security review: the sidecar only listens on localhost, scrapes are pull-only, and nothing leaves the pod unencrypted. No credentials are baked into the image — everything comes in at deploy time. The sidecar's runtime configuration is the following.

service settings:
WENATH_PIN=5007
WENATH_METRICS_HOST=metrics.wenath.tolvaqlabs.corp
WENATH_LOG_LEVEL=debug
WENATH_TENANT=rusox

Quarterly Planning Note — Divestiture of the Coastal Tooling Unit

For the finance team: the sale of the Coastal Tooling unit to Pellmark Industries remains on track for close in Q3. Please finalize the carve-out balance sheet, reconcile intercompany positions, and prepare the working-capital adjustment schedule by month-end. Audit support requests should be prioritized. For planning purposes, note the following sensitive item:

internal memo for hawef-kahif: The finance team signed off on a budget of $25.9 million for Project Sorox. The renewal with Pelokek Logistics closes at $51.7 million a year, 52 percent below the last contract.

## Changelog — Ticktrace 1.9

### Renamed: DRIFT_API_TOKEN
During the cron drift investigation we found plugins confusing this variable with the metrics token, so it has been renamed to indicate it authorizes drift-report uploads specifically. Plugin authors must read the new name from 1.9 onward; the old name is ignored without warning. Sample env files in the SDK are updated. In your deployment env file, the drift-report upload secret is set on the next line.

env line for fawef-taguf: VAULT_KEY13=a9695905a9a90